маршрут не загружает компонент внутри вложенного компонента маршрута - PullRequest
0 голосов
/ 19 апреля 2019

Я загружаю свой adminDashboard компонент в app.js с Route. теперь в adminDashboard на основе URL, я хочу сделать некоторые компоненты. но он не загружает какой-либо компонент. также нет активности на вкладке сети в консоли Chrome.

если я отрисовываю их без Route, они отрисовываются правильно.

app.js

class App extends Component {

  render() {
    let { error, success } = this.props;
    const Admin = Authorization(['admin'])
    return (
      <div className='app'>
        <AdminNavbar logout={this.props.logout}/>
        <Switch>
          <Route exact path='/admin/signin' render={(props) => {
              return <AuthForm />
            }}
          />
          <Route exact path='/admin' component={Admin(AdminDashboard)} />
        </Switch>
        <Footer />
      </div>
    );
  }
}

Компонент MyComponent

const MyDashboard = (props)=> ` this is dashboard`

Admindashboard

class AdminDashboard extends Component{
    render() {
        return (
            <div>
                <div className='row'>
                    <div className='col-md-2'>
                        <NavBar  />
                    </div>
                    <div className='col-md-10'>
                        < Commisions /> //working properly if i load it without route
                        <Switch>

                            <Route exact path='/admin/dashboard' component={MyDashboard} /> // not work
                            //some other route
                        </Switch>
                    </div>
                </div>
            </div>
        )
    }
}
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...